Economy & Jobs

East Bronson residents earn a median household income of $51,405 , which is 32% below the national average of $75,149. Per capita income is $31,499. The unemployment rate stands at 0.9% (75% below the U.S. rate of 3.6%). 17.2% of residents live below the poverty line. The area is home to 1,134 business establishments, including 92 restaurants.

Housing & Cost of Living

The median home value in East Bronson is $119,700 , 58% below the national median of $281,900. Zillow estimates the typical home at $270,052. The cost of living index is 103.4 (100 = national average). The median home was built in 2001.

Safety & Crime

East Bronson reports 184 violent crimes per 100,000 residents , which is 52% below the national average of 380/100K. Property crime is 3,818/100K.

Education

12.5% of adults in East Bronson hold a bachelor's degree or higher (63% below the national average). 78.0% have completed high school. Local schools score 5.1/10 in standardized testing.

Climate & Weather

East Bronson has an average annual temperature of 69°F (21°C). Winters average 55°F in January while summers reach 81°F in July. The area gets 314 sunny days per year. Annual precipitation totals 57.1 inches. Air quality is rated Good with a median AQI of 41.
